Seating

When shopping for a heavy-duty power chair, it is important to think about the seating capacity. A greater weight capacity means the chair is able to accommodate people with a larger height and size, making it easier for them to move about comfortably. Additionally, a higher capacity can allow the use of powered mobility aids such as elevating leg rests that reduces the pressure on legs and aids in blood circulation.

Other aspects to consider when selecting a wheelchair include the battery’s longevity, drive range and extra features. A quick-charge battery, for instance, can reduce the time between charges, and improve your mobility. A dual battery connector can also increase the mobility of your wheelchair. This is accomplished by connecting two batteries.

The range of the drive system of a heavy duty power handicap chair electric can affect its performance with front-wheel drives providing tighter turning radiuses and more maneuverability. Rear-wheel drive chairs provide greater stability when navigating rough terrain and curbs. Additionally, a recline power system can enhance the comfort of a wheelchair by making it easier to relax into a position and lessening tension in your back, neck or shoulders.

Another feature to look for is a warranty policy, which can provide peace of mind in the event that something goes wrong with your chair. A lot of companies offer a guarantee of one year on the frame and six months for electronic components. They also offer repair or replacement options.

Capacity for Weight

When selecting a power chair, the weight capacity is an important factor to consider. Heavy duty power wheelchairs can be heavier than regular chairs and are made for heavier users. These chairs are also more durable and have motors that are stronger and have stronger frames. Some are bariatric chairs, which are safe for obese users.

When choosing a chair, take into account the user’s weight and daily needs when evaluating the capacity of the wheelchair’s weight. Overweight can cause damage to the motor and frame and can also decrease the battery’s lifespan. It can also put the user at risk of injury because of a lack of stability. A chair with a greater capacity for weight is an investment, therefore it is essential to evaluate the user’s health and mobility needs before making a purchase.

Make sure to regularly inspect your power chair to ensure its safety. Examine the casters and lubricate as needed. Clean your chair often to get rid of dust and dirt. Also, be sure to maintain the batteries and charger. If you are unsure how to properly care for your wheelchair, talk to healthcare professionals or a mobility specialist.

Battery Life

The battery life of heavy duty electric wheelchairs varies greatly. It’s based on different factors, such as how much the chair is used in the day, the terrain it drives over and its weight.

The battery will be put under greater strain if the wheelchair has to do more work to move forward. It is crucial to not use your wheelchair on difficult or uneven terrain, as it can decrease the lifespan of the battery.

Another aspect that affects longevity of the wheelchair’s battery is the frequency at which it’s charged. Many people make the mistake of only charging their batteries when they’re low but this could result in them being overcharged and decrease their life span. It’s better to charge the battery at least once a day, preferably every night.

It’s also a good idea when the battery is not in use, to store it at room temperature (77deg F). Batteries aren’t a fan of extreme temperatures and keeping them at either high or low temperatures can decrease their lifespan. It is also an excellent idea for terminals of batteries to be cleaned and lubricated with petroleum jelly. This will stop corrosion and protect the internal plates.

Mobility

Heavy duty power wheelchairs offer top rated electric wheelchairs-of-the-line mobility features. They usually have larger frames and more powerful motors than smaller electric chairs, which makes them great for bariatric users. They’re also made to handle greater weight capacities and offer more comfortable seats that can be adjusted to suit different needs.

They’re usually more expensive than standard electric wheelchairs, however, they’re more durable and offer more choices for customization. Some models have legrests that swing away to allow you to get in and out of your chair. Some come with a powered elevating seat that lets you change your seat height for the perfect design.

The majority of models are controlled by the joystick located on the armrest making them easy to maneuver for those suffering from upper body injuries or weakness. They can reach speeds of up to 4 and 4.5 miles per hour, and offer a range of between 9.8 and 22 miles.
